Isolation of Endophytic Fungi in Rhododendron and Its Control against Tribolium castaneum and Ditylenchus destructor

Abstract: Twenty-two strains of endophytic fungi were screened from Rhododendron thymifolium, R. capitatum, R. anthopogonoide, and R. przewalskii using culture isolation method and their insecticidal activities were investigated. The results indicated that crude extracts of LS-Y-2 mycelium showed a better pesticide activity against Tribolium castaneum (LD50=69.31 μg/adult), crude extracts of LS-Y-2 fungal liquid showed a good bioactivity against T. castaneum (FDI=84.28%) and Ditylenchus destructor (LC50=0.06 mg/mL), crude extracts of TH-Z-1 fungal liquid showed an obvious pesticide activity against D. destructor (LC50=0.07 mg/mL), crude extracts of LS-Y-4 fungal liquid showed a better antifeedant activity against T. castaneum (FDI=73.12%), crude extracts of LS-Y-4 mycelium showed a better pesticide activity against D. destructor (LC50=0.18 mg/mL). LS-Y-2 and LS-Y-4 belong to Alternaria, TH-Z-1 belong to Trametes.
